Message type: E = Error
Message class: TFW - Template Framework
Message number: 072
Message text: No text in language &1 found for read method &2

- No text in language &1 found for read method &2 ?The SAP error message TFW072 indicates that the system is unable to find a text in the specified language for the read method you are trying to use. This typically occurs in scenarios where text elements are expected but are missing for the specified language.
Cause:
- Missing Texts: The most common cause is that the text for the specified language (denoted by
&1
) is not maintained in the system for the specified read method (denoted by&2
).- Incorrect Language Settings: The language settings in the user profile or the system configuration may not match the available texts.
-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the data or configuration that lead to the absence of the required text.
Solution:
Maintain Texts:
- Go to the relevant transaction (e.g., SE63 for translation or SE11 for data dictionary objects) to maintain the missing texts for the specified language.
- Ensure that the texts for the read method are properly defined and saved.
Check Language Settings:
- Verify the language settings in your user profile. You can check this in the user settings (transaction SU01) to ensure that the correct language is set.
- If you are working in a multi-language environment, ensure that the texts are available in the required languages.
Debugging:
- If you have access to debugging tools, you can trace the execution to see where the error is being triggered and gather more context about the missing text.
Consult Documentation:
- Review the documentation for the specific module or function you are working with to understand the expected texts and their configurations.
Contact Support:
- If you are unable to resolve the issue,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or consulting SAP Notes for any known issues related to this error message.
